If theft, that is a poor idea. Anyone who knows ANYTHING about an old Mopar knows you just jumper the relay......you can use "anything" metal including a nickel or penny!!!
You have a tach? "Or not" one effective theft prevention if you have a conventional ignition (NOT MSD/ CDI) is to put an unobtrusive switch to ground your tach wire.
Another.......if you have an electric pump......is a switch in the pump relay
If they show up with a "rollback" or a wrecker.......you need a wireless alarm system.
